Description

A high-strength structural end plate made from 40% glass-fiber reinforced PPS, designed to provide uniform clamping pressure and chemical insulation for fuel cell stacks.

Basic Information

Material Composition PPS + 40% Glass Fiber
Thickness (μm) 15000
Density (g/cm³) 1.65
Surface Resistance (mΩ·cm²) Insulator
Tensile Strength (MPa) 160
Thermal Conductivity (W/m·K) 0.3
Operating Temp Max (°C) 220
Flexural Strength (MPa) 240
Corrosion Resistance (μA/cm²) Excellent
Contact Angle (°) 85
Coefficient of Thermal Expansion (10⁻⁶/K) 20
Shore Hardness 88 (Shore D)
Water Uptake (%) < 0.05
Ash Content (%) 40 (Fiber)
Mean Pore Size (μm) N/A
Compressive Strength (MPa) 220
Electrical Conductivity (S/cm) < 10⁻¹²
Specific Surface Area (m²/g) N/A
Young's Modulus (GPa) 14
Chemical Stability Resistant to Glycol
Coating Material None
Surface Roughness (Ra) 1.5
